
About Max Webster
Max Webster was a Canadian rock band of the late 1970s. The band was formed in 1973 in Sarnia, Ontario and consisted of guitarist and vocalist Kim Mitchell, keyboardist Terry Watkinson, bassist Mike Tilka and drummer Paul Kersey. Mitchell, joined by Pye Dubois [aka Paul Woods], would write the majority of their material with Mitchell writing the music and Dubois writing lyrics. Kersey left the band after their self-titled debut album, to be replaced by Gary McCracken.
